> On 7/8/26 6:40 AM, Daniel P. Berrangé wrote:
> > Is the solution not a matter of making the binfmt-misc handler always
> > be installed by the core wine RPM, and droppping the .desktop file ?
> >
> > Upstream quite reasonably wants to use a .desktop file because that
> > offers greater platform portability. The secrity scenario with flatpaks
> > sandboxing is only a Linux problem (at least right now). Portability
> > of .desktop files is not relevant for Fedora though, so surely we can
> > diverge a little rely on the binfmt-misc file alone and not register
> > the mime handler ?
>
> I'll be making that change the next time I have time to update wine, which has
> lacked an update for too long.

Thank you!

> I tried reviewing the history of having binfmt registration a separate package but I
> didn't see a reason. It's been this way since 2011.
